Tiffanie Stone
Dept: Natural Resource Ecology and Management (NREM) and Env. Sci. Projected Grad: 2023 Advisor: Janette Thompson
Research Interest:
I am working with an interdisciplinary research team developing models to integrate local food systems, climate dynamics, built forms and environmental impacts into the urban food, energy, water system (FEWS) nexus. I am using survey tools, focus groups, and land use GIS to analyze and visualize food system sustainability from environmental, economic, and socio-political perspectives. I am particularly interested in understanding how to design for equity and in urban food systems.
